| Ryan Switzer -
RB/DB - Charleston
(W.Va.) Washington |
Record: 11-3
Game Result: lost to Martinsburg, 63-14, in the semifinals
of the WVSSAC AAA playoffs.
Statistics:
ran for 148 yards and a touchdown and 69 yards on four catches. He also
threw a touchdown pass.
Quotable:
"I knew it was going to be a challenge," Switzer told
the Journal News. "They do some great things defensively, but we kind
of shot ourselves in the foot with turnovers."
"Anytime he touches the ball in the running game, [Switzer] has the
potential to go the distance," Martinsburg defensive coordinator Buddy
Hesen told the Journal News.
"Switzer is blinding fast," Martinsburg linebacker Kyle Britner told
the Journal News. "We worked on gathering together with everyone,
swarming to keep him in."
-- Journal
News

| Mitch Trubisky -
QB - Mentor (Ohio) |
Record: 12-2
Game Result: lost to Toledo Whitmer, 62-34, in the Division I,
semifinal of
the OHSAA playoffs.
Statistics:
completed 27-of-38 passes for 353 yards, three touchdowns (30, 20, and
21 yards), and two interceptions. He also rushed for 121 yards on 26
carries with two scores (1 and 8 yards).
Quotable:
"I think you see what kind of young man he is, what kind of football
player he is and what a great job he's done in this program," Mentor
head coach Steve Trivisonno told the Plain Dealer. "He's played in
eight playoff games and that's pretty impressive, especially with the
young kids he had around him."
"I think it had to be the players around me and the great coaches we
have," Trubisky told the Plain Dealer. "I wouldn't want to play
football anywhere else. It was just a great career. I did my best, week
in and week out. The numbers just popped up. I hope people enjoyed
watching me because I enjoyed playing for this community."
"He was all that I saw on film and then some tonight," Witmer head
coach Jerry Bell told the Plain Dealer. "He's an unbelievable football
player, and he deserves every award and accolade that he gets. He's
unbelievable, and he put his team to be in position to be successful
tonight. We were just able to make a few more plays than they did."
-- Plain
Dealer |
